A Space Invaders mini game rendered with a post it note style. ;) Well worth seeing it in motion... download or youtube video (it lessens the effect since it's a downsampled resolution, at least watch in HQ).
Frameranger, the winning demo at Assembly 2009 by CNDC, orange, & Fairlight:
At 5 minutes in, there's a great shift to 8-bit music style and a block push pixelated render target. Check out the capped.tv video.
